A very good question I like to ask in talks like this is "How do you define Mr. Right or Mrs. Right?"

And every time I get a response, there never seems to be a right answer.

This utopian notion of Mr. Right is actually shutting doors for people. We spend so much time searching that we forget that the first place to start is with ourselves. If we find Mr or Miss Right, do we actually look like Mr or Miss Right to that person?

That is where people miss it. Because truth be told no matter how right a person appears in the first instance, as time goes on there would be reasons why he may not look like the right person. You know why? Because you would have seen another person whose strengths look like the answer to the current guys weaknesses. But we forget that this new guy also has his own weakness which will also be answered in another person's strengths and it goes on and on.

So when exactly will you find Mr right? True happiness does not lie in finding Mr right. It lies in being able to enjoy the strengths of the one you are with and at the same accepting his weaknesses.
